Recognizing LASIK Surgery: How It Functions



When you think about LASIK surgery, it's important to comprehend how it works to make a notified decision.

LASIK, or Laser-Assisted In Situ Keratomileusis, improves your cornea making use of a laser to remedy common vision issues like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.

During the procedure, your surgeon develops a slim flap on the cornea's surface, lifts it, and exactly improves the underlying cells with the laser. This process permits light to focus correctly on your retina, boosting your vision.

The flap is after that repositioned, promoting rapid recovery. The whole surgical treatment generally lasts about 15 mins per eye, and the majority of individuals experience considerable vision renovation within a day.

Advantages and Dangers of LASIK



After understanding how LASIK surgical procedure functions, it is very important to weigh the advantages and dangers entailed.



One major benefit is the capacity for clear vision without glasses or get in touches with, which can improve your day-to-day tasks and total lifestyle. Most clients experience prompt improvement and take pleasure in lasting outcomes.

Nonetheless, there are risks to think about, such as dry eyes, glow, or perhaps vision loss in uncommon cases. Not every person is an ideal candidate, so a comprehensive assessment is crucial.

You might likewise deal with prices that insurance policy frequently doesn't cover. Stabilizing these elements will assist you make an informed choice concerning whether LASIK is the right choice for you.
